Otisco, NY is a small rural community located in Onondaga County with a population of 2,578 and a population density of 86 people per square mile. The population in Otisco is 2,578. There are 87 people per square mile aka population density. The median age in Otisco is 41.7, the US median age is 38.4. The number of people per household in Otisco is 2.5, the US average of people per household is 2.6.
Family in Otisco
- 64.0% are married
- 9.2% are divorced
- 38.4% are married with children
- 11.4% have children, but are single
